    Motorcycle carburetor.

    If a lot of gasoline is sprayed into the cylinder and it does not catch fire, this situation may be caused by the carburetor oil level is out of control, and the cylinder is flooded due to excessive oil intake.

    If there is too much oil in the cylinder of the motorcycle, you should check whether the oil level of the carburetor is too high, whether the float is damaged or stuck and cannot float with the oil surface, resulting in the loss of control of the oil level, whether the float needle valve is worn or stuck by the tiny impurities in the gasoline, resulting in poor closure, so that the oil level is out of control, whether the main measuring hole falls off, damaged or other reasons cause the nozzle hole to be too large, which will cause a lot of oil to enter the cylinder.

    In addition, if the motorcycle is overturned, gasoline may flow directly into the cylinder from the fuel tank and carburetor through the intake pipe between the carburetor and the engine, causing excess gasoline in the cylinder. If too much gasoline enters the cylinder, it will wet the spark plugs.

    And cause the mixture to be too thick and flooded the cylinder, so that the spark plug can not be ignited normally, resulting in the inability to start.

    In addition, too much gasoline can leak into the engine crankcase and gearbox through the gap between the cylinder block and the piston and piston rings.

    Internally, it is mixed with engine oil, resulting in more oil, thinner and worse lubrication effect, affecting the lubrication quality of the engine, and also causing oil leakage, increased engine wear and other failures. Therefore, in this case, after ruling out the fault of too much oil in the cylinder and unable to start, the oil condition in the engine should also be checked, and if the gasoline has penetrated into it and mixed with the oil, the oil must be replaced.

    The 125 scooter has gasoline in its carburetor, but it cannot supply fuel to the engine, which is usually caused by a clogged carburetor. You can remove the carburetor from the car and clean it carefully, clean the dirt in the carburetor with carburetor cleaner or gasoline, blow through the various nozzles and nozzles in the carburetor with the compressed air of the air pump or the daredevil, if the nozzle holes are seriously blocked, you can also use thin steel wire to dredge, but be careful not to scratch or scratch the nozzle holes, otherwise the carburetor will be damaged.

    Check the carburetor mix ratio, oil level, oil needle, vacuum membrane and electronically controlled damper for problems, which can also affect the carburetor oil supply. Check whether the negative pressure fuel tank switch is damaged, as well as whether the suction pipe of the negative pressure fuel tank switch is leaking, whether the gasoline filter is blocked, whether there is no gasoline in the tank or there is too little gasoline, etc., these will also affect the fuel supply.

    In addition, check whether the cylinder pressure is too low, whether the valve clearance is too small or the valve is not closed tightly due to carbon deposit, wear, ablation, etc., whether there is a slight leakage in the intake pipe and other hoses related to the engine, carburetor, secondary air intake system, negative pressure fuel tank switch, etc., and whether the gasoline oil quality is too poor, etc., which will also cause the failure of no oil supply or similar no oil supply.

    Reason: The carburetor is not sprayed, but sucked in by the negative pressure of the piston movement, just like a syringe absorbs water or inhales. If the tank runs out of oil, or the pipes in the carburetor are clogged, the mixer will not work.

    The simple carburetor consists of three parts: the upper part has the air intake port and float chamber, the middle part has the throat, measuring hole and nozzle, and the lower part has the throttle valve.

    The float chamber is a rectangular container that stores gasoline from a gasoline pump, and a float inside the container controls the amount of fuel intake by using the height of the float (oil level). One end of the nozzle is connected to the measuring hole of the float chamber, and the other end of the nozzle is at the throat of the throat.

    1. The oil level is too low: the oil level of the carburetor is too low, which is mostly due to improper adjustment. In order to pursue the low fuel consumption of the vehicle, some riders and maintenance personnel blindly adjust the float to reduce the oil level in the float chamber, and use the engine to absorb less fuel at the same speed to reduce fuel consumption, in fact, this method does not outweigh the losses.

    2. The oil level is too high: the needle valve and the needle valve seat oil sealing working surface are worn, and the wear of the needle valve is the most serious. When the needle valve is worn, a cut mark (introduced) is formed on the working face of the needle valve, because the needle valve and the needle seat can not be automatically centered, the fuel will continue to flow into the float chamber, resulting in the oil level being too high.

    3. The replacement accessories are not suitable: the matching gap between the needle valve and the guide sleeve is, if the gap is too small, it will affect the start and close of the oil inlet, resulting in the loss of control of the carburetor oil level, but this kind of fault phenomenon is less.
